How to conjugate otorgar in Indicative Present Continuous in Spanish

otorgar
to grant, to award, to give
regular verb

Otorgar means to give, grant, or award something to someone. It is often used in formal contexts such as granting rights, awards, or permissions.

How to conjugate otorgar in Indicative Present Continuous

El Presente Progresivo - used to talk about something that is happening continuously or right now

Indicative Present Continuous Conjugations

PronounConjugation
Yo
estoy otorgando
estás otorgando
Él / Ella / Usted
está otorgando
Nosotros / Nosotras
estamos otorgando
Vosotros / Vosotras
estáis otorgando
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
están otorgando

Examples of otorgar in Indicative Present Continuous

Yo
Estoy otorgando premios a los ganadores.
I am granting awards to the winners.
Estás otorgando demasiada confianza.
You are granting too much trust.
Él / Ella / Usted
Ella está otorgando permisos ahora.
She is granting permissions now.
Nosotros / Nosotras
Estamos otorgando becas este año.
We are granting scholarships this year.
Vosotros / Vosotras
Vosotros estáis otorgando ayuda rápidamente.
You all are granting help quickly.
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
Ellos están otorgando permisos especiales.
They are granting special permissions.
